#f2f1d8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f2f1d8 is composed of 94.9% red, 94.5%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 10.7%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 57.7 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 89.8%. #f2f1d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e5e3b1.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#f2f1d8 color description : Light grayish yellow.

#f2f1d8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f2f1d8 has RGB values of R:242, G:241,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15921624.

Shades and Tints of #f2f1d8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050502 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f2f1d8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e6e6e4 is the less saturated color, while #fefccc is the most saturated one.
